Posted by daDouce Man on Tue Nov 3 14:52:00 2009, in response to Re: Nostrand Ave., posted by Michael549 on Tue Nov 3 13:23:55 2009. Sometimes people have to word their questions better.Many times people would ask where they'd get the L train to 14 Street. I'd ask what Avenue they want. After all there are no stations on the L line called 14 Street. There's 1 Ave, 3 Ave, Union Sq, 6 Ave and 8 Ave. When they told me what Ave, I gave them an answer. When they were (very) annoyed I couldn't read their minds where, I'd tell them 1 Ave which likely was the last station they wanted. |
